Description of ZM 522

ZM 522 is an inhibitor of ecto-5'-nucleotidase, also known as CD73 (IC50s = 0.56 and 3.06 µM for the human and mouse enzymes, respectively), and a derivative of the triterpenoid betulinic acid .1 It increases the levels of IFN-γ secreted by isolated mouse spleen cells when used at a concentration of 10 µM in the presence of AMP.

Chemical Properties of ZM 522

Cas No. 1454575-38-2 SDF
Formula C37H51FO4 M.Wt 578.8
Löslichkeit DMF: 10 mg/ml,DMSO: 2 mg/ml,Ethanol: 2 mg/ml Storage Store at -20°C
